Manchester City Council are pulling out all the stops this year in celebration of St George's Day.
With something for everybody, below are details of the St George's Day Festival and Parade.
St. George's Day Parade
Although St George's Day is on Saturday the 23rd, the parade is taking place on Sunday the 24th April from 11.45 until 1.45pm.
For full details of the route see the map below.
Starting on Varley Street at 11:45 am, the parade winds it's way down Oldham St, through Piccadilly, back into the Northern Quarter and Ancoats, before ending up back at Varley St.
For a great vantage point in the City, the parade is predicted to reach Piccadilly at 12:30pm if you want a good vantage point.
Expect to see Mods, Samba Bands, Maidens and Knights of Old on the parade route.
The St. George's Day Street Festival runs from 11:30am – 4pm, with street theatre and music performers and comedians. So if you don't feel like parading, Piccadilly Gardens is the spot for you as that's where it all happens.
The Post Parade Street Party kicks off at 1:30pm in the Adactus Car Park, just off Varley Street. There will be more performers on show alongside traditional home-comforts like tea, coffee and the great British Banger.
